In Warsaw we landed on the alternative terminal Etiuda that used to be a domestic (military) one but now is being used by the European low-cost airlines. We discovered that this was where the infamous "taxi mafia" has moved from the main Okecie terminal. Having a good recent experience in Okecie we assumed that the "mafia" was gone but we were wrong.
When we tried to get into the taxi the driver asked us where we wanted to go and then quoted an outrageous fare. On the matter of principle I quoted back some choice words and we went to a public bus that was waiting at a stop literally 20 metres away.
It certainly was one of those trips that we will remember for a long time. With Iceland having particularly impressed me, I have spent a lot of time (and money) researching various topics, reading a complete history of the country and a number of novels by the country's Nobel Prize winner Halldor Laxness. Maybe I'll get a chance to go there again.
And yes, a few months later the Flygbussarna bus company did pay us back the full cost of the taxi and even of the bus tickets for that unfortunate trip to the Stockholm airport.
